#64c424 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#64c424 is composed of 39.2% red, 76.9%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.6%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 96 degrees, a saturation of 69% and a lightness of 45.5%. #64c424 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ff48 with #008900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

● #64c424 color description : Strong green.
The hexadecimal color #64c424 has RGB values of R:100, G:196,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 6603812.
